The thing about that is that even if a developer were to make The Sims, they'd have to heavily invest in and allocate the resources for a game that'd compete with the first and only game of its kind. I think it's generally underestimated just how much of the sales of The Sims come from the name. How many people are buying TS4 not because of the new features, but because it's The Sims 4, and the features are just happy extras. Other games just can't compete, not just because of scale and detail, but because anything that isn't called "The Sims" is just a knockoff version of the real thing. Branding it powerful like that.

There are a lot of things EA probably has locked down, definitely the engine and probably things as simple as the interaction UI. People would buy the game only to realize that a lot of the things they're used to the way they're used to that are changed/moved/gone/have other things in their place. Big developers aren't willing to take the risk of creating a comparable game (that is, in all fairness, 3 generations in with established gameplay ((though they are cutting a lot of the gameplay in the 4th generation))) and indie studios don't have the resources to make a game anywhere near the scale of TS. The only way I see for another company to develop a game like it is to buy the rights to it, and even then I'd hope it was a reliable developer that has the capacity to respect The Sims like the cash cow it already is without having to squeeze every possible penny out of it.

To be honest, the CAS demo made me even less excited for the game. I've spent too many times watching other people playing it and thinking to myself that it didn't look that special - certainly not to carry the whole marketing as it did. So while some things are nice (style is pretty much improved, organization is good and the hat/hair combination is great), others are much worse than I thought before getting my hands on it.

The hair textures are trully horrible, which is funny because some of them have far better textures than others, it's really inconsistent (only thing consistent is that blond always look terrible). It makes changing hair styles harder than it should be, because some of the bad textured hairs look even worse depending on the color, which, on the other hand, can be the best color for another hair. I wonder what the hell went on with that, but trying to understand the atrocious decisions regarding this game is probably a waste of time. Not even "they suck" can explain those, so I decided to moved on.

Speaking of colors, why are they so ashy for body parts and so bright for outfits? Hair and skintone look terrible - the lighter or blonder the hair, the worse it looks. For outfits, on the other hand, yellow or green make the clothing look like they have no texture at all, like they were painted on Microsoft Paint. Weird.

Also, the lack of a color wheel is really hurting the game - you can't experiment too much with outfits because some of them won't match no matter how many recolors they put there. It's almost like you have to match them exactly as imagined by developers. Not even shades of black are the same. I couldn't even use a pair of black formal pants because their black was different from the black on the top, it was lighter I think. Only option was to use the one "meant" to go with it.

It really, really sucks because the options given are very limited, and sometimes, all you need is to adjust the color just a little bit to get that look you imagined. I don't know if I am picky or what, but sometimes, I have a tone in my head that bugs me forever if it can't be matched. So if outfits are not matching, I can only imagine how hard it will be to decorate a house having to realy on such options.
